commit: ff75392625d2e7ccb9763529b94cd53dc3939018 Author: Viorel Munteanu <ceamac <AT> gentoo <DOT> org> AuthorDate: Thu Jul 10 10:27:31 2025 +0000 Commit: Viorel Munteanu <ceamac <AT> gentoo <DOT> org> CommitDate: Thu Jul 10 10:35:13 2025 +0000 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=ff753926
media-libs/mesa-amber: fix build with gcc-15 The patch is quite trivial, apply direct to stable. Closes: https://bugs.gentoo.org/941612 Signed-off-by: Viorel Munteanu <ceamac <AT> gentoo.org> media-libs/mesa-amber/files/mesa-amber-21.3.9-gcc-15.patch | 12 ++++++++++++ media-libs/mesa-amber/mesa-amber-21.3.9-r1.ebuild | 1 + media-libs/mesa-amber/mesa-amber-21.3.9-r2.ebuild | 1 + 3 files changed, 14 insertions(+) diff --git a/media-libs/mesa-amber/files/mesa-amber-21.3.9-gcc-15.patch b/media-libs/mesa-amber/files/mesa-amber-21.3.9-gcc-15.patch new file mode 100644 index 000000000000..21570b85e0c4 --- /dev/null +++ b/media-libs/mesa-amber/files/mesa-amber-21.3.9-gcc-15.patch @@ -0,0 +1,12 @@ +https://bugs.gentoo.org/941612 + +--- a/src/gtest/src/gtest-death-test.cc ++++ b/src/gtest/src/gtest-death-test.cc +@@ -46,6 +46,7 @@ + # include <errno.h> + # include <fcntl.h> + # include <limits.h> ++# include <cstdint> + + # if GTEST_OS_LINUX + # include <signal.h> diff --git a/media-libs/mesa-amber/mesa-amber-21.3.9-r1.ebuild b/media-libs/mesa-amber/mesa-amber-21.3.9-r1.ebuild index 7e8199a0aba7..edb0d769c375 100644 --- a/media-libs/mesa-amber/mesa-amber-21.3.9-r1.ebuild +++ b/media-libs/mesa-amber/mesa-amber-21.3.9-r1.ebuild @@ -96,6 +96,7 @@ x86? ( PATCHES=( "${FILESDIR}"/${PN}-i915c.patch + "${FILESDIR}"/${P}-gcc-15.patch ) python_check_deps() { diff --git a/media-libs/mesa-amber/mesa-amber-21.3.9-r2.ebuild b/media-libs/mesa-amber/mesa-amber-21.3.9-r2.ebuild index 42b88cd4d967..33aa0e67d219 100644 --- a/media-libs/mesa-amber/mesa-amber-21.3.9-r2.ebuild +++ b/media-libs/mesa-amber/mesa-amber-21.3.9-r2.ebuild @@ -95,6 +95,7 @@ x86? ( PATCHES=( "${FILESDIR}"/${PN}-i915c.patch + "${FILESDIR}"/${P}-gcc-15.patch ) python_check_deps() {
